Proper Studio Space and Gear for Indoor Sessions

For indoor sessions, professional photographers invest in having their own dedicated studio spaces outfitted with gear to totally control the environment.

Having an array of lighting options like strobe monolights, reflectors and soft box light modifiers allows crafting flattering illumination studio-wide. Backdrops from simple black to vividly colored provide options. Props add further visual interest to shots.

In a DIY home studio, lighting often casts uneven shadows and colors look off. Backgrounds appear wrinkled and messy. A pro studio with high-end gear produces polished results impossible otherwise.

So for indoor sessions, pro studios ensure the quality of environments. At outdoor shoots, they bring portable lighting tools to sculpt natural light on location.

If product photography is needed, pros have tabletop studios with specialized gear like light tents and macro lenses to capture clear, vivid product images. Their toolset enhances shots.

Knowledge of Flattering Posing and Composing Images

Posing is another area that benefits from professional expertise. The way subjects position their body and expressions impacts portraits immensely. Photographing someone who appears stiff or awkward fails to produce an appealing feel.

Experienced pros direct posing gracefully. They know how to coach stance, hand placement, and chin level strategically to conceal problem areas and emphasize assets. Their instructions result in comfortable, natural looking poses.

Pros also skillfully compose shots by adjusting camera angle, perspectives and framing. They construct scenes leveraging principles like the rule of thirds to create balanced aesthetic looks.

Without this knowledge, shots often showcase distracting elements and uncomfortable, unflattering posing. Photos fail to do subjects justice. Working with an adept pro fixes this.

Vetting Top Photographers Carefully

Clearly, there’s immense value in hiring seasoned professional talent for portrait work rather than trusting an amateur. But not every photographer claiming “pro” status offers equal skill. Do your homework to pick the best fit.

Here’s how to vet candidates:

  • Review online portfolios looking for diverse, consistent work quality.
  • Check client testimonials and reviews for red flags about professionalism.
  • Interview potential hires about their experience, vision and approach.
  • Ask for pricing transparency upfront and avoid hidden fees.
  • Make sure response time is prompt and communication style connects.
  • Confirm they have insurance covering shoots.
  • Request references and sample full galleries.
  • Opt for someone enthusiastic who asks questions and listens.

Taking time to evaluate photographers thoroughly upfront saves disappointment later. It helps securing someone truly aligned with your needs.
